Ensure the SFP module is compatible with your network device. Modules must adhere to MSA (Multi-Source Agreement) standards for mechanical dimensions and pinouts, but electrical and optical compatibility must also be verified. Some switches enforce vendor-specific EEPROM coding, and using an unsupported module can result in ports remaining down or error messages . Always check the host device documentation and confirm that the module is recognized and supported.

Choose a module that meets the required link distance. Short-reach (SR) modules are cost-effective for intra-data center connections, while long-reach (LR/ER/ZR) modules are needed for campus or inter-building links .

Modules with Digital Diagnostics Monitoring (DDM/DOM) allow real-time monitoring of temperature, voltage, and transmit/receive power, which is critical for proactive maintenance and ensuring link reliability .
